            Kevin Dolan

            Event: (200057) Leeds United at (200058) Southampton
            Sport/League: SOC (See all free soccer picks)
            Date/Time: May 18, 2021 1PM EDT
            Play: Bothe Teams to Score & Over 2.5 (-138)
            Southampton look a new side of late as Ralph Hasenhuttl continues to push this team forward in an effort to keep his job.
            Leeds meanwhile are winding down the season playing with abandon, putting 4 goals past Burnley last time out on their travels and with little to play for in regards to table placement for either side, another high scoring encounter is expected.
            Overall this season, Leeds have averaged 1.53 xg per game, 6th highest in the league, while Southampton haven't kept a clean sheet at home since January.
            We expect goals in this one and like the combination bet of Both Teams to Score & Over 2.5 at -138 to cash on Tuesday.
            PLAY: BOTH TEAMS TO SCORE & OVER 2.5 -138

                  Tony Finn

                  Event: (559) Charlotte Hornets at (560) Indiana Pacers
                  Sport/League: NBA (See all free NBA picks)
                  Date/Time: May 18, 2021 6PM EDT
                  Play: Charlotte Hornets +2.0 (-110)
                  The National Basketball Association postseason is here, and it all beings on Tuesday, May 18th, when the ninth-seeded Indiana Pacers host the 10th-seed Charlotte Hornets at Bankers Life Fieldhouse. Tip-off for the 2021 playoff opener is scheduled for 6:30 pm ET.
                  The loser of Tuesday's first postseason event will be eliminated from the Association Championship bracket. The winner between these two Eastern Conference teams will advance to match up against the loser of Tuesday's doubleheader nightcap between the seven-seed Boston Celtics and the eight-seed Washington Wizards.
                  The Hornets exhibited an edge in the three regular-season games between these two, winning a pair of the three contests. The most recent between the two franchises found the Hornets earned a 114-97 game at Bankers Life Fieldhouse in early April. It was a matchup after the Pacers decided to sacrifice defense for more offensive possession, pace per se, and Charlotte still managed to keep Indy from reaching the century mark. The Free Pick for Tuesday's early play-in affair is a play on "I want to be like Mike" and his Hornets.

                    The Prez

                    Event: (927) Detroit Tigers at (928) Seattle Mariners
                    Sport/League: MLB (See all free MLB picks)
                    Date/Time: May 18, 2021 10PM EDT
                    Play: Total Under 8.0 (-105) S Turnbull (RHP), J Dunn (RHP) Must Start
                    927 Detroit Tigers at 928 Seattle Mariners -125, 8

                    The American League Central last-place Detroit Tigers are on the road for Game 2 of a 3-game set versus the Seattle Mariners. The first pitch on Tuesday is scheduled for 10:10 p.m. EDT. The Tigers have positioned Spencer Turnbull (2-2, 3.91) to start in a matchup against the Mariners Justin Dunn (1-1, 3.72).
                    Turnbull is fully stretched out now and will square off against the free-swinging Seattle lineup. Turnbull's high groundball rate and the Mariners' high percentage of strikeouts make this a favorable start for the Tigers ace. Dunn has struck out eight across his last nine innings. Dunn's six strikeouts vs. the Orioles two starts back was a season-high for the righty.
                    It is Year Five of a five-year rebuild plan for Detroit, and the prospects of them being a contender in the AL Central are delusional. The struggles of the Tigers' top two pitching prospects are a big concern, and Detroit’s best hitter this year is Robbie Grossman.
                    Free Pick for Tuesday is a play Under the Total of 8 at T-Mobile Park
